dnl @synopsis XERCES_TRANSCODER_SELECTION
dnl
dnl Determines the which transcoder to use
dnl
dnl @category C
dnl @author James Berry
dnl @version 2005-05-23
dnl @license AllPermissive
dnl
dnl $Id$
AC_DEFUN([XERCES_TRANSCODER_SELECTION],
[
######################################################
# Test for availability of each transcoder on this host.
# For each transcoder that's available, and hasn't been disabled, add it to our list.
# If the transcoder has been explicitly "enable"d, then vote for it strongly,
# in upper case.
######################################################
tc_list=
# Check for GNU iconv support
no_GNUiconv=false
AC_CHECK_HEADERS([iconv.h wchar.h string.h stdlib.h stdio.h ctype.h locale.h errno.h], [], [no_GNUiconv=true])
# The code in iconv needs just on of these include files
AC_CHECK_HEADER([endian.h],
[],
[
AC_CHECK_HEADER([machine/endian.h],
[],
[
AC_CHECK_HEADER([arpa/nameser_compat.h],
[],
[no_GNUiconv=true])
])
])
AC_CHECK_FUNCS([iconv_open iconv_close iconv], [], [no_GNUiconv=true])
AC_MSG_CHECKING([whether we can support the GNU iconv Transcoder])
list_add=
AS_IF([! $no_GNUiconv], [
AC_ARG_ENABLE([transcoder-gnuiconv],
AS_HELP_STRING([--enable-transcoder-gnuiconv],
[Enable GNU iconv-based transcoder support]),
[AS_IF([test x"$enableval" = xyes],
[list_add=GNUICONV])],
[list_add=gnuiconv])
])
AS_IF([test x"$list_add" != x],
[tc_list="$tc_list -$list_add-"; AC_MSG_RESULT(yes)],
[AC_MSG_RESULT(no)]
)
# Check for iconv support
no_iconv=false
AC_CHECK_HEADERS([wchar.h], [], [no_iconv=true])
AC_CHECK_FUNCS([mblen wcstombs mbstowcs], [], [no_iconv=true])
AC_MSG_CHECKING([whether we can support the iconv Transcoder])
list_add=
AS_IF([! $no_iconv], [
AC_ARG_ENABLE([transcoder-iconv],
AS_HELP_STRING([--enable-transcoder-iconv],
[Enable iconv-based transcoder support]),
[AS_IF([test x"$enableval" = xyes],
[list_add=ICONV])],
[list_add=iconv])
])
AS_IF([test x"$list_add" != x],
[tc_list="$tc_list -$list_add-"; AC_MSG_RESULT(yes)],
[AC_MSG_RESULT(no)]
)
# Check for ICU
AC_REQUIRE([XERCES_ICU_PREFIX])
AC_MSG_CHECKING([whether we can support the ICU Transcoder])
list_add=
AS_IF([test x"$xerces_cv_icu_present" != x"no"], [
AC_ARG_ENABLE([transcoder-icu],
AS_HELP_STRING([--enable-transcoder-icu],
[Enable icu-based transcoder support]),
[AS_IF([test x"$enableval" = xyes],
[list_add=ICU])],
[list_add=icu])
])
AS_IF([test x"$list_add" != x],
[tc_list="$tc_list -$list_add-"; AC_MSG_RESULT(yes)],
[AC_MSG_RESULT(no)]
)
# Check for platform-specific transcoders
list_add=
case $host_os in
darwin*)
AC_MSG_CHECKING([whether we can support the MacOSUnicodeConverter Transcoder])
AS_IF([test x"$ac_cv_header_CoreServices_CoreServices_h" = xyes], [
AC_ARG_ENABLE([transcoder-macosunicodeconverter],
AS_HELP_STRING([--enable-transcoder-macosunicodeconverter],
[Enable MacOSUnicodeConverter-based transcoder support]),
[AS_IF([test x"$enableval" = xyes],
[list_add=MACOSUNICODECONVERTER])],
[list_add=macosunicodeconverter])
])
AS_IF([test x"$list_add" != x],
[tc_list="$tc_list -$list_add-"; AC_MSG_RESULT(yes)],
[AC_MSG_RESULT(no)]
)
;;
windows* | mingw*)
AC_MSG_CHECKING([whether we can support the Windows Transcoder])
AC_ARG_ENABLE([transcoder-windows],
AS_HELP_STRING([--enable-transcoder-windows],
[Enable Windows-based transcoder support]),
[AS_IF([test x"$enableval" = xyes],
[list_add=WINDOWS])],
[list_add=windows])
AS_IF([test x"$list_add" != x],
[tc_list="$tc_list -$list_add-"; AC_MSG_RESULT(yes)],
[AC_MSG_RESULT(no)]
)
;;
cygwin*)
# Only add it to the list if the user explicitly asked
# for it.
#
AC_MSG_CHECKING([whether to use the Windows Transcoder])
AC_ARG_ENABLE([transcoder-windows],
AS_HELP_STRING([--enable-transcoder-windows],
[Enable Windows-based transcoder support]),
[AS_IF([test x"$enableval" = xyes],
[list_add=WINDOWS])])
AS_IF([test x"$list_add" != x],
[tc_list="$tc_list -$list_add-"; AC_MSG_RESULT(yes)],
[AC_MSG_RESULT(no)]
)
;;
esac
# TODO: Tests for additional transcoders
######################################################
# Determine which transcoder to use.
#
# We do this in two passes. Transcoders that have been enabled with "yes",
# and which start out in upper case, get the top priority on the first pass.
# On the second pass, we consider those which are simply available, but
# which were not "disable"d (these won't even be in our list).
######################################################
transcoder=
az_lower=abcdefghijklmnopqrstuvwxyz
az_upper=ABCDEFGHIJKLMNOPQRSTUVWXYZ
AC_MSG_CHECKING([for which Transcoder to use (choices:$tc_list)])
for i in 1 2; do
# Swap upper/lower case in the tc_list. Cannot use tr ranges
# because of the portability issues.
#
tc_list=`echo $tc_list | tr "$az_lower$az_upper" "$az_upper$az_lower"`
# Check for each transcoder, in implicit rank order
case $tc_list in
*-icu-*)
transcoder=icu
AC_DEFINE([XERCES_USE_TRANSCODER_ICU], 1, [Define to use the ICU-based transcoder])
LIBS="${LIBS} ${xerces_cv_icu_libs}"
break
;;
*-macosunicodeconverter-*)
transcoder=macosunicodeconverter
AC_DEFINE([XERCES_USE_TRANSCODER_MACOSUNICODECONVERTER], 1, [Define to use the Mac OS UnicodeConverter-based transcoder])
XERCES_LINK_DARWIN_FRAMEWORK([CoreServices])
break
;;
*-gnuiconv-*)
transcoder=gnuiconv
AC_DEFINE([XERCES_USE_TRANSCODER_GNUICONV], 1, [Define to use the GNU iconv transcoder])
break
;;
*-windows-*)
transcoder=windows
AC_DEFINE([XERCES_USE_TRANSCODER_WINDOWS], 1, [Define to use the Windows transcoder])
break
;;
*-iconv-*)
transcoder=iconv
AC_DEFINE([XERCES_USE_TRANSCODER_ICONV], 1, [Define to use the iconv transcoder])
break
;;
*)
AS_IF([test $i -eq 2], [
AC_MSG_RESULT([none])
AC_MSG_ERROR([Xerces cannot function without a transcoder])
]
)
;;
esac
done
if test x"$transcoder" != x; then
AC_MSG_RESULT($transcoder)
fi
# Define the auto-make conditionals which determine what actually gets compiled
# Note that these macros can't be executed conditionally, which is why they're here, not above.
AM_CONDITIONAL([XERCES_USE_TRANSCODER_ICU], [test x"$transcoder" = xicu])
AM_CONDITIONAL([XERCES_USE_TRANSCODER_MACOSUNICODECONVERTER], [test x"$transcoder" = xmacosunicodeconverter])
AM_CONDITIONAL([XERCES_USE_TRANSCODER_GNUICONV], [test x"$transcoder" = xgnuiconv])
AM_CONDITIONAL([XERCES_USE_TRANSCODER_ICONV], [test x"$transcoder" = xiconv])
AM_CONDITIONAL([XERCES_USE_TRANSCODER_WINDOWS], [test x"$transcoder" = xwindows])
]
)
